    Abstract: A signal tracking system including: one fixation element to be secured to a rigid body part of the patient surrounding a target body part, the fixation element further including a mapping element, one tracker element to be secured to the fixation element to track, in real time, the internal tracker, and a control unit including a memory to store an internal referential and one image displaying the target body part and one fixation element. The control unit is designed to define, inside the internal referential, at least one 3D frame position attached to the at least one fixation element, and to precisely locate each point of the target body part, the control unit is further designed to precisely localize, in real time, the internal tracker inside the target body part.

    Abstract: A mechatronic device includes two arms extending from a base in a first direction and shaped to be handheld by an operator, the two arms having free ends forming a gripper and arranged to move closer together by rotation from a rest position to an active position, a motor housed in the base, an actuator mounted between the arms, and a means for controlling said actuator, the actuator connected to the motor so as to be driven in movement in translation in the first direction. The actuator also has a first contact surface that forms a cam with a respective second contact surface on each arm, the first contact surface remaining engaged with the second contact surface. The control means controls the movement in translation of the actuator to produce a movement in rotation of the arms that applies a chosen force of the gripper in its active position.

    Abstract: A touch interface includes a display screen and detects an approach and a position of a user's finger with respect to the screen. The interface displays at least one first graphical element associated with a first touch selection zone and lying in a first region and at least one second graphical element superimposed on a second touch selection zone, and lying in a second region distinct from the first region. The interface estimates a trajectory of a point of the finger and a point of impact of the trajectory on the screen. The interface displaces, when the point of impact is detected in one of the regions, the graphical element of the region and the associated touch selection zone in the direction of the point of impact, and then, when the point of impact exits the region, restore the display of the graphical element to an initial state.

    Abstract: A touch interface includes a display screen. The interface detects an approach and a position of a finger of a user with respect to the screen. The interface displays on the screen at least one graphical element associated with a touch-selection zone, surrounding an anchor point of the graphical element on the screen. The interface estimates a trajectory of a point of the finger and an impact point of the trajectory on the screen, and moves the graphical element in the direction of the impact point, when a distance between the anchor point and the impact point falls below a first threshold.

    Abstract: Asynchronous information is provided by a sensor having a matrix of pixels disposed opposite the scene. The asynchronous information includes, for each pixel of the matrix, successive events originating from this pixel, that may depend on variations of light in the scene. A model representing the tracked shape of an object is updated after detecting events attributed to this object in the asynchronous information. Following detection, the updating of the model includes an association of a point of the model with the event detected by minimizing a criterion of distance with respect to the pixel of the matrix from which the detected event originates. The updated model is then determined as a function of the pixel of the matrix from which the detected event originates and attributed to the object and of the associated point in the model, independently of the associations performed before the detection of this event.
